Biography
After graduation from the University of Leeds in 1992 (MB ChB), Dr Booton completed general professional training in West Yorkshire (Bradford & Airedale) and Specialist Respiratory/ general Internal Medicine Training in the North West, becoming a Member of the Royal College of Physicians in 1998. He developed a sub-speciality interest in Thoracic Malignancy, working extensively at the North West Lung Centre, The Christie Hospital and The Paterson Institute for Cancer Research, Manchester and successfully completed a thoracic oncology fellowship (Supervisor: Prof N Thatcher) and a PhD thesis on the pharmacogenomics of lung cancer in 2006.
Dr Booton is a founding member of the British Thoracic Oncology Group and currently serves on the Steering Committee. He also serves on the locoregional disease sub-committee of the NCRI Lung Cancer Group. Locally, Dr Booton has played a leading role in the development of the Manchester Cancer Research Centre lung cancer strategy and the development of lung cancer services at the regional thoracic centre, University Hospital of South Manchester. He sits on the MCRC Biobank Board.
Dr Booton's is a Clinical Senior Lecturer & Honorary Consultant Respiratory Physician in the School of Translational Medicine at The University of Manchester focussing on the development of a new thoracic oncology research group and portfolio in the early detection of thoracic malignancy and leads on two national portfolio studies, employs 3 research fellows, and 2 research nurses and an NIHR Clinical Lecturer. He has active collaborations with The Wolfson Molecular Imaging Centre (Prof Whetton), The University of Manchester (Dr Lindsay/ Dr Griffiths Jones/ Prof Radford/ Dr Linton/ Dr Blackhall) and AstraZeneca Pharmaceuticals (Dr D Blowers/ Prof A Hughes)/ Allegro Diagnostics (Boston, USA). To date grant income approaches £1M.
